Quick Answer
U0BA5 means: The U0BA5 code indicates a communication problem within the vehicle's control modules.
Can I drive with U0BA5? Address this issue as soon as possible to avoid further complications.
Common Questions
What does U0BA5 mean and how does it affect my car?
The U0BA5 code signifies a communication issue between your vehicle’s control modules, which can lead to various operational problems. If left unaddressed, it can cause further complications affecting the reliability and safety of your vehicle.
What are the most common causes of U0BA5 and how much does it cost to fix?
Common causes include damaged wiring, malfunctioning control modules, and corrosion. Repair costs can range from $150 for simple wiring fixes to over $1,200 for control module replacements.
Can I drive my car with U0BA5 or should I stop immediately?
While you may be able to drive your vehicle, it's not advisable to ignore the U0BA5 code. Driving with this code can lead to erratic behavior and potential safety risks, so it’s best to address the issue as soon as possible.
How can I diagnose U0BA5 myself using GeekOBD APP?
Using the GeekOBD APP, you can scan for DTCs, review freeze frame data, and monitor live vehicle data to identify potential issues. Look for discrepancies in communication between modules and specific error codes related to the U0BA5.
What vehicles are most commonly affected by U0BA5?
The U0BA5 code is often seen in 2016-2020 Jeep Grand Cherokees, but it can occur in various vehicles equipped with complex electronic systems. Check for any recalls or technical service bulletins (TSBs) related to your specific model.
How can I prevent U0BA5 from happening again?
Regular maintenance, including inspections of wiring and connectors, can help prevent the U0BA5 code from recurring. Avoid installation of aftermarket electrical devices that may interfere with the vehicle's communication systems.
What is U0BA5?
The DTC U0BA5 code indicates a communication issue within the vehicle’s systems, often related to a malfunction in the Controller Area Network (CAN) bus. This code is particularly common in 2016-2020 Jeep Grand Cherokee models but can appear in various other vehicles equipped with advanced electronic systems. When U0BA5 is triggered, it usually signifies that one of the modules responsible for managing vehicle functions is unable to communicate properly with others. This can lead to several operational issues, including erratic behavior of electronic components, dashboard warning lights, and in some cases, reduced vehicle performance. For the vehicle owner, this means that if you see the U0BA5 code, it’s essential to address it promptly to prevent further complications. Ignoring this code may lead to larger issues down the line, such as complete system failures or additional DTCs appearing. Moreover, if the issue persists, it may result in a vehicle that is less safe and reliable. Therefore, understanding and resolving the U0BA5 code is crucial for maintaining the functionality and safety of your vehicle.
System: U - Network (Communication, CAN Bus)
Symptoms
Common symptoms when U0BA5 is present:
- The check engine light remains illuminated, indicating a persistent issue that needs attention.
- Electrical components may behave erratically, such as the radio cutting out or dashboard lights flickering, which can be frustrating for the driver.
- You might notice a decline in fuel efficiency, with reports showing reductions up to 10-20% due to compromised electronic control.
- In some cases, the vehicle may enter 'limp mode,' restricting power and speed to protect the engine from damage.
- There may be delayed responses from the throttle, leading to hesitation during acceleration, which is not only inconvenient but can also pose safety risks.
Possible Causes
Most common causes of U0BA5 (ordered by frequency):
- The most common cause of the U0BA5 code is damaged wiring or connectors in the CAN bus system, with a likelihood of 50%. This can happen due to wear and tear or exposure to moisture.
- Another possible cause is a malfunctioning control module, such as the body control module (BCM), which may not send or receive data correctly. This can result from software issues or internal failures.
- Corrosion in electrical connectors can also lead to intermittent communication failures, making it crucial to check for signs of rust or moisture. Preventive measures include regular inspections and cleaning of connectors.
- Less common but serious causes include a damaged or faulty CAN bus, which may require extensive repairs or replacement of the entire network.
- A rare cause could be interference from aftermarket devices, such as alarms or stereo systems, that disrupt the normal communication between modules.
U0BA5 Repair Costs
Cost Breakdown by Repair Type
Wiring Repair
Repairing or replacing damaged wiring or connectors in the CAN bus system.
- Total: $150 - $400
- Success rate: 85%
Control Module Replacement
Replacing a faulty control module, such as the BCM.
- Total: $400 - $1,200
- Success rate: 90%
CAN Bus Repair
Repairing or replacing sections of the CAN bus.
- Total: $200 - $600
- Success rate: 80%
Money-Saving Tips for U0BA5
- Start with the most common and least expensive repairs first
- Use GeekOBD APP to confirm diagnosis before replacing expensive parts
- Consider preventive maintenance to avoid future occurrences
- Compare prices for OEM vs aftermarket parts based on your needs
- Address the issue promptly to prevent more expensive secondary damage
Diagnostic Steps
Professional U0BA5 Diagnosis Process
Follow these systematic steps to accurately diagnose U0BA5. Each step builds on the previous one to ensure accurate diagnosis.
Step 1: Step 1: Start with an initial visual inspection; check for damaged wiring, loose connections, or signs of corrosion, which typically takes about 5-10 minutes
Step 1: Start with an initial visual inspection; check for damaged wiring, loose connections, or signs of corrosion, which typically takes about 5-10 minutes.
Step 2: Step 2: Use the GeekOBD APP to perform an OBD2 scan
Step 2: Use the GeekOBD APP to perform an OBD2 scan. Retrieve all diagnostic codes and freeze frame data to understand the context of the fault, which can take around 10-15 minutes.
Step 3: Step 3: Conduct component testing using a multimeter or specialized diagnostic tools to check the health of suspected components, allowing 20-30 minutes for thorough testing
Step 3: Conduct component testing using a multimeter or specialized diagnostic tools to check the health of suspected components, allowing 20-30 minutes for thorough testing.
Step 4: Step 4: After making repairs, perform a system function test to verify the proper operation of all related systems and clear the codes, which usually takes around 10-15 minutes
Step 4: After making repairs, perform a system function test to verify the proper operation of all related systems and clear the codes, which usually takes around 10-15 minutes.
Step 5: Step 5: Finally, take the vehicle for a road test under various conditions to ensure that the issue has been resolved and that no new codes appear, allowing 15-20 minutes for this step
Step 5: Finally, take the vehicle for a road test under various conditions to ensure that the issue has been resolved and that no new codes appear, allowing 15-20 minutes for this step.
Important Notes
- Always verify the repair with GeekOBD APP after completing diagnostic steps
- Clear codes and test drive to ensure the problem is resolved
- Address underlying causes to prevent code recurrence
Real Repair Case Studies
Case Study 1: Jeep Grand Cherokee U0BA5 Resolution
Vehicle: 2018 Jeep Grand Cherokee, 45,000 miles
Problem: Customer reported dashboard warning lights and erratic behavior of electronic components.
Diagnosis: Initial visual inspection revealed damaged wiring in the CAN bus, confirmed with GeekOBD scan showing U0BA5.
Solution: Replaced damaged wiring and connectors, re-scanned to confirm the issue was resolved.
Cost: $250
Result: The vehicle's systems returned to normal operation, and no further codes appeared after the repair.
Case Study 2: Control Module Malfunction in a 2017 Jeep Grand Cherokee
Vehicle: 2017 Jeep Grand Cherokee, 60,000 miles
Problem: Customer experienced intermittent electrical issues and performance drops.
Diagnosis: GeekOBD scan indicated U0BA5; further testing revealed a faulty body control module.
Solution: Replaced the body control module and updated the software.
Cost: $1,000
Result: Post-repair tests showed no issues; performance was restored and stable.